Prayer For Business Success

Prayer for business success:

Dear God, we come to You today with a prayer for our business. We know that we are not always in control of the outcomes of our businesses and that sometimes things just don’t work out as planned. But even when we don’t have total control, we know that You are always working in our behalf.

Please help us to be diligent in our efforts and to trust in Your timing and guidance. We know that whatever happens in this business, it is only temporary; it will all eventually lead back to You. In Jesus’ name, amen.

What To Pray For When Starting Or Running A Business

When starting or running a business, there are many things you can pray for. Below is a list of some specific things to pray for when starting your own business:
1. Guidance from God – Pray for guidance in all aspects of your business, from what you should do to how you should do it. Ask Him to show you the right path and protect and guide you throughout the process.
2. A positive mindset – Pray that you will have a positive attitude and outlook towards your business, no matter what happens. Stay focused on the goals you set for yourself and don’t let anything (positive or negative) get in the way of reaching them.
3. Financial stability – Pray that your business will be profitable and sustainable, both now and in the future. Ask God to provide guidance in managing finances and protecting your assets.
4. Opportunities to grow – Pray for opportunities to grow your business both organically and through acquisitions or partnerships. Be open to opportunities as they come, trusting that God will lead you where He wants you to go.
5. Continued success – Pray that your business will continue to be successful long after you’ve left it behind, thanks in part to the blessings You’ve given it during its time under Your care.

How To Set Up A Regular Prayer Routine For Your Business

Regular prayer for your business can help you connect with God and increase your chances of success. Here are five steps to setting up a regular prayer routine for your business:

1. Choose a time each day to pray. Pick a time that works best for you, whether it’s in the morning, afternoon, evening or night.
2. Pray about what’s going on in your business. Ask God for help with decisions, guidance and strength during this time.
3. Thank God for everything He’s done for your business so far and ask Him to continue blessing it.
4. Give Him praise when things go well and apologize when they don’t go as planned.
5. Connect with other believers through prayer circles or Bible study groups to help you grow closer to God and learn from one another.
